Vermilya, James I.

Senate 1915-18 (District 4)

Party when first elected:  Nonpartisan Election

Counties Served:  Olmsted

BIOGRAPHICAL INFORMATION

Date of Birth: ??/??/1849
Birth Place: Oswego, New York
Birth County:
Birth Country: United States
Date of Death:
Gender: Male
Religion:
Reported Minority: None Reported
Other Names:
City of Residence (when first elected): Quincy
Occupation (when first elected): Farmer

GENERAL NOTES

He came to Olmsted County, Minnesota in 1863 with his parents.
